Sharif admits Nur Khan base was struck: ‘Munir rang me up at 2.30am’
Posted
Pakistani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if has formally acknowledged that India conducted missile strikes on the Nur Khan airbase in Rawalpindi on May 9-10. This admission contradicts previous Pakistani statements that downplayed the extent of the damage. BJP leaders have asserted that Sharif's words confirm the scale and precision of Operation Sindoor.
